Output 08e89857225f2680ec0ca1dd65be5d8367181dde1fe33e8b0debf1b3d94d202a:1

value
866743
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 01f955f55ac16a7b8cc1ecb5b755e0ce1338376e OP_EQUALVERIFY OP_CHECKSIG
address
1BSNM2EcD6p3ni9L8aLVtsqjTGWC4pRes
transaction
08e89857225f2680ec0ca1dd65be5d8367181dde1fe33e8b0debf1b3d94d202a
confirmations
510148
spent
true